艺术作为普遍语言,其内涵丰富且多义。随着大语言模型(LLMs)和多模态大语言模型(MLLMs)的发展,人们开始思考这些模型能否用于评估与解读艺术品中的艺术元素。尽管已有相关研究,但据我们所知,尚未深入探索利用大模型对艺术品的技术特征与表达内涵进行细致分析。本研究致力于自动化形式化艺术分析框架,实现对大量艺术作品的高效分析,并考察其风格模式随时间的演变。我们探索了大模型如何解码艺术表达、视觉元素、构图与技法,揭示出跨越历史时期的新兴模式。最后,讨论了大模型在此任务中的优劣,强调其处理海量艺术数据并生成深刻见解的能力。由于结果详尽且颗粒度精细,我们开发了交互式数据可视化工具,可在 https://cognartive.github.io/ 在线访问,以提升理解与可及性。

Art, as a universal language, can be interpreted in diverse ways, with artworks embodying profound meanings and nuances. The advent of Large Language Models (LLMs) and the availability of Multimodal Large Language Models (MLLMs) raise the question of how these transformative models can be used to assess and interpret the artistic elements of artworks. While research has been conducted in this domain, to the best of our knowledge, a deep and detailed understanding of the technical and expressive features of artworks using LLMs has not been explored. In this study, we investigate the automation of a formal art analysis framework to analyze a high-throughput number of artworks rapidly and examine how their patterns evolve over time. We explore how LLMs can decode artistic expressions, visual elements, composition, and techniques, revealing emerging patterns that develop across periods. Finally, we discuss the strengths and limitations of LLMs in this context, emphasizing their ability to process vast quantities of art-related data and generate insightful interpretations. Due to the exhaustive and granular nature of the results, we have developed interactive data visualizations, available online https://cognartive.github.io/, to enhance understanding and accessibility.
